As cool as Andrew Garfield's portrayal of one my all time favorite superheroes is, this movie was bad because they OVERDID it. Two villains was stretching it a bit, and making a third (and that too, one of the best ever villains AND the most important villain in Spider-Man history imo) was a BAD MOVE AND THEY SHOULD HAVE SAVED IT FOR LATER. The design of the Goblin was terrible, and anyone who followed the Spidey comics knew that the Goblin's appearance in a movie with Stacy wasn't going to end well for her. All in all, shit villains, but good character development on Spider-Man's part. Honestly though, the villains. That's the best part, and it went wrong.

The movie dragged on at points, but it wasn't bad. Jamie Foxx was surprisingly good as the insecure Electro, and Andrew Garfield kept up the wise-cracking within Spiderman's character well. My only real complaint was the massive advertisement of two other villains, who barely got ANY screentime until the very end.
